Kano Gov: How my former deputy tried removing me from office, failed

Date:

By Lateef Ibrahim, Abuja

Governor of Kano State, Alhaji Abba Yusuf has revealed that his former deputy, Aminu Abdussalam Gwarzo, made attempt to remove him from office, with a view to taking over the reins of power before his eventual resignation.

The Governor specifically said that what happened was an effort by his erstwhile deputy to remove him from his position and take over, but that the plan did not succeed.

Alhaji Yusuf, who spoke on Friday while playing host to a group of praise singers, Mawallafan Abba Gida Gida, at the Government House in Kano, equally said he was yet to see the resignation letter of his former deputy.

Friday’s comments by the Kano State Governor was, apparently, his first public reaction to the political rift that culminated in his deputy’s exit.

The immediate past Deputy Governor of Kano State, it will be recalled, had recently stepped down from office in the wake of impeachment move initiated by the State House of Assembly against him.

The impeachment move was, however, subsequently jettisoned following the resignation of Gwarzo.

The governor, while receiving his visitors, maintained that he was yet to receive any formal resignation letter from his former deputy.

He expressed serious surprise over the circumstances surrounding his (Gwarzo’s) resignation.

His words, “Today, the deputy governor elected alongside us is no longer in office.

“To the best of my knowledge, no wrongdoing was committed against him.

“I have not even seen his resignation letter,” he declared.

The Governor, who had since dumped the New Nigeria Peoples’ Party, (NNPP), The party that bought him into office, for the ruling All Progressives Congress, APC,

said that Abdussalam’s actions were part of a failed attempt to unseat him and assume control of the state government.

His words, “What happened was an effort to remove me from this position and take over, but that plan did not succeed”.
